Output 17627696b543137b446f63a952ebfbabfb481aa9a4ae0f8ce334c7e99ebce4e1:0

value
106810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91b240b9f7818d92dd71b98e2e768c0dd92551d3 OP_EQUAL
address
MMBXkUCwqAn9nBVXxHSZNhinYWp7nwUi5Q
transaction
17627696b543137b446f63a952ebfbabfb481aa9a4ae0f8ce334c7e99ebce4e1
spent
true